HedgeDoc (formerly known as CodiMD) is an open-source collaborative markdown editor. With HedgeDoc you can easily collaborate on notes, graphs and even presentations in real-time. All you need to do is to share your note-link to your co-workers, and they’re ready to go.
Collaborate in real-time with friends, family and colleagues.
Use HedgeDoc to build and present slides in markdown. Powered by reveal.js!
HedgeDoc supports many types of graphs, diagrams and embeddings.
Manage permissions of your notes with a simple dropdown selection.
Revisions keep track of changes to your notes and even let you revert to any older version.
HedgeDoc doesn’t need much resources. It even runs smooth on a Raspberry Pi!

Yes, this project was formerly known as CodiMD, but in 2020 we decided to rename our project to HedgeDoc to avoid confusion with another project of the same name.

The HedgeDoc source code is available on GitHub and licensed under AGPL 3.0. Everything is open source and free as in free speech. Read it, understand it, help us to improve it!
